Definition
'Greyer' is the comparative form of 'grey', meaning more grey in color or appearance.
Usage & Nuances
'Greyer' is used mostly for color comparisons, appearance (such as hair or weather), and sometimes metaphorically for mood or atmosphere. It is a chiefly British spelling; the American spelling is 'grayer'. Use 'greyer than' to compare two things.
